How are domestic violence cases processed in Brazil and what protection measures are available?
Cases of domestic violence in Brazil are processed through the Maria da Penha Law, which establishes protection measures such as restraining orders, psychological and social assistance to the victim, and the prohibition of the aggressor from approaching the victim or communicate with her. In addition, measures can be taken such as arresting the aggressor and assigning custody of the children to the victim.

What is the legal age to become emancipated in Bolivia?
Emancipation in Bolivia can be requested from the age of 16. However, the process involves parental or guardian approval and court authorization. Emancipation grants the minor certain legal rights and responsibilities.
